Cheese Wizard COB (Cheese Wizard.cob)

This is an interesting type of
vendor. It injects the popular web-
graphic wizard1.gif into your world.
When pushed, either by you or a
creature, it magically creates one of
three randomaly chosen food items.
The first is native to albia, cheese.
It's affects, in case you don't know,
are as follows...

Chemical	|Amount
-------------------------------------
Hunger Decrease	|250
NFP Decrease	|10
Starch		|150

The next item is a pear-ike fruit.
Being such, it's very sweet. It's
affects are as follows...

Chemical	|Amount
-------------------------------------
Hunger Decrease	|200
NFP Decrease	|50
Starch		|50
Vitamin C	|200

As you can see, it would be a fine
treat, but isn't completely lacking
nutrition. Moving on... This next one
is intersting. It's a fruit. However,
it has protective spikes that can be
just a slight bit painful on your
creature's pallet. It's affects are
as follows...

Chemical	|Amount
-------------------------------------
Hunger Decrease	|100
NFP Decrease	|50
Starch		|100
Pain		|50

Installation of COB

First of all, the Cheese Wizard.cob
file needs placed in your Creatures
directory. The wizard vendor uses the
cwiz.spr sprite file and that should
be placed in the Images folder within
your Creatures directory. It also
uses the hslt.wav sound file. That
should already be in the Sounds
folder within your Creatures
directory, but it's provided just in
case. This object's family, genus,
and species are 2, 8, and 100
respectively.

The cheese uses the food.spr sprite
file and that should already be in
the Images folder within your
Creatures directory, but it's
included just in case. It also uses
the chwp.wav, drop.wav, and chwc.wav
sound files. These should already be
in the Sounds folder within your
Creatures directory, but they're
provided just in case. This object's
family, genus, and species are 2, 6,
and 1 respectively.

The pear-like fruit uses the cwiz.spr
sprite file and that should be placed
in the Images folder within your
Creatures directory. It also uses the
chwp.wav, drop.wav, and chwc.wav
sound files. These should already be
in the Sounds folder within your
Creatures directory, but they're
provided just in case. This object's
family, genus, and species are 2, 6,
and 100	respectively.

The spiky fruit uses the cwiz.spr
sprite file and that should be placed
in the Images folder within your
Creatures directory. It also uses the
chwp.wav, drop.wav, and chwc.wav
sound files. These should already be
in the Sounds folder within your
Creatures directory, but they're
provided just in case. This object's
family, genus, and species are 2, 6,
and 101	respectively.

The Remover File (Cheese Wizard.rcb)

Basically, this file will remove all
wizard vendors that you have in your
world. It does not remove the food
items. I think it would be dumb to
ever create a remover for a food item
considering that they do not harm
creatures and can be eaten.

_____________________________________
Installation of Remover

This is really easy! All that you
must do is place Cheese Wizard.rcb in
your Creatures directory. Voila.
